The Telecommunications Access Policy Division (Division) has under consideration the above- captioned Requests for Review of decisions issued by the Schools and Libraries 1 Federal Communications Commission DA 03- 38 2 Division (SLD) of the Universal Service Administrative Company. 1 These requests seek review of SLD decisions pursuant to section 54.719( c) of the Commission’s rules. 2 2. The Commission’s rules provide that the Wireline Competition Bureau (Bureau) must issue a decision resolving a request for review of matters properly before it within ninety (90) days unless the time period is extended. 3 The Bureau requires additional time to review the issues presented. Accordingly, we extend by an additional sixty (60) days the deadline by which the Bureau must take action regarding the instant Requests for Review of decisions by the SLD. 3. Accordingly, IT IS ORDERED, pursuant to section 54.724( a) of the Commission's rules, 47 C. F. R. § 54.724( a), that the time period for taking action in the above- captioned Requests for Review IS EXTENDED BY an additional sixty (60) days to January 31, 2003, for the Request for Review filed by Baltimore County Public Schools, Towson, Maryland; to February 17, 2003, for the Request for Review filed by Banning Unified School District, Banning, California; to February 4, 2003, for the Request for Review filed by Burgundy Farm Country Day School, Alexandria, Virginia; to February 17, 2003, for the Request for Review filed by Our Lady of Refuge School, Brooklyn, New York; to February 14, 2003, for the Request for Review filed by Prairie Hills Elementary School District No. 144, Hazel Crest, Illinois; to February 4, 2003, for the Request for Review filed by School District of the Wisconsin Dells, Wisconsin Dells, Wisconsin; to February 28, 2003, for the Request for Review filed by Stafford Municipal School District, Stafford, Texas.
